Borczak scores in second minute of added time to send hosts to 2-1 victory at H-E-B Park

EDINBURG, Texas – Dylan Borczak scored in second-half stoppage time as Rio Grande Valley FC took its second consecutive league victory with a 2-1 win against Sacramento Republic FC at H-E-B Park on Saturday night.

Sacramento almost struck first in the fifth minute when Emil Cuello was played into space on the right and clipped a cross that was headed just over the crossbar by Luther Archimede. Chances proved difficult to come by overall for both sides before the break, however, with the Toros’ first good look on goal coming three minutes before halftime as Juan David Cabezas fired over the crossbar from the top of the penalty area.

RGVFC brought on Stefan Mueller as a substitute to start the second half, and that move paid off just past the hour-mark when he helped the hosts open the scoring. A break down the left by Mueller saw him deliver a chipped cross into the penalty area that was met at the back post by a first-time finish by Luka Malesevic that found the top-right corner of the net. Republic FC hit back with 18 minutes to go as a free kick by Rodrigo Lopez from outside the top-right corner of the penalty area was mis-cleared by RGVFC’s Wahab Ackwei, allowing Conor Donovan to tap in from inside the six-yard area for the visitors.

Borczak delivered all three points for the Toros in stoppage time, however, as Jonathan Ricketts stole possession on the right flank and surged forward, delivering a cross that deflected off a defender at the near post and sat up ideally for the first-year pro, who fired home from the top of the six-yard area to send the hosts to a much-needed win.  

USLChampionship.com Player of the Match

Luka Malesevic, Rio Grande Valley FC – Malesevic scored a fine opening goal for the hosts, had three shots overall and won 9 of 12 duels and 3 of 4 tackles in midfield to help the Toros to victory.
